Indeed, there are days when you don’t feel to ride – due to the weather, or maybe because you’re not feeling as energetic etc.

One thing I discovered that sometimes helps, is to have your ‘lazy day’ so to speak but prep for a ride the next morning. Perhaps starting the mental process by cleaning your bike. Then, the next morning early: RIDE! No matter how foul the weather or how you feel. You decide how long, how far. You can make it a very short ride, but often you’ll discover that joy is upon you :-) Once home: relax, take a shower, drink a cup of tea ...
